AI Enters Wealth Management

Fintech platform OneVest has launched an AI-powered agentic operating system for wealth management. The company immediately partnered with Merit Financial, a $24 billion RIA, for a rapid national rollout. The move signals a broader trend of integrating AI into every layer of financial services, moving toward what some call "agentic wealth."

Merit Financial's partnership with OneVest is a strategic move to support an aggressive M&A strategy. The firm, which doubled its assets to over $24 billion in the last year, is targeting an additional 15 acquisitions in 2026 and needed a platform to quickly and efficiently integrate new advisory teams. OneVest's "Agentic Wealth Operating System" moves beyond simple AI-powered insights, which have largely focused on note-taking and reminders. The platform is designed to execute core operational workflows, automating tasks like client onboarding, account openings, fund movements, fee billing, and compliance processes. The key distinction is the shift from passive dashboards to "agentic" AI that executes tasks autonomously. This intelligent execution layer is designed to eliminate what OneVest calls the "Legacy Tax"—the hours advisors lose to manual data entry and managing fragmented systems. This technology directly targets the high operational costs in wealth management, which can range from 35 to 50 cents per dollar of revenue. By automating middle-office functions like trade confirmations and data reconciliation, the goal is to reduce overhead, minimize errors, and free up advisors to focus on client relationships. Merit Financial operates over 55 offices with more than 150 advisors. As of January 1, 2026, its $24.69 billion in assets were broken down into $17.86 billion in advisory, $2.73 billion in brokerage, $2.3 billion in retirement assets, and $1.8 billion in ESOP assets. The deal reflects a broader industry push where AI-managed assets are projected to exceed $6 trillion by 2027. A recent Fidelity survey found that more than two-thirds of wealth management firms are already using generative AI, with 80% of users reporting tangible increases in efficiency.
